One of the most significant benefits of moisture-proof ceilings is their durability. Traditional materials like drywall are prone to mold and mildew when exposed to high humidity. In contrast, moisture-proof ceilings often use materials like PVC, fiberglass, or specially treated wood that resist water damage. This durability not only extends the life of the ceiling but also reduces the need for frequent repairs or replacements, making it a smart investment.
Installation is another area where moisture-proof ceilings shine. Many of these products are designed for easy installation, often featuring interlocking panels or drop-in designs. This means homeowners can achieve a sleek, professional look without the need for extensive renovations. Plus, many moisture-proof ceilings can be installed over existing ceilings, saving time and money on demolition.
